Aniline Hydrochloride (142-04-1): Properties, Handling, and Safety in Industrial Use
Aniline hydrochloride (CAS 142-04-1) is a chemical compound with specific physical and chemical properties that necessitate careful handling and storage protocols in industrial settings. Typically presented as a white to pale yellow-cream powder, it has a melting point of approximately 196-198°C and is soluble in water. These characteristics are fundamental for its application in various chemical syntheses, but also inform the necessary safety measures.
From a safety perspective, aniline hydrochloride is classified with certain hazard warnings. It can be toxic if swallowed, inhaled, or comes into contact with the skin. Potential for skin and eye irritation, as well as skin sensitization, requires app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), including gloves, protective clothing, and eye protection. It is also important to avoid breathing dust or fumes. When working with this compound, adherence to safety guidelines, such as using it only in a hood or well-ventilated area, is paramount. Storage recommendations for aniline hydrochloride often include keeping it in a cool, dry place, away from light, and ensuring containers are tightly closed, as it can be light-sensitive and may discolor on exposure to light and air. These conditions help maintain the compound's stability and shelf life. Proper storage not only preserves the chemical integrity but also prevents potential hazards associated with degradation or accidental release.
